Arbor: Essentials for SENCOs
This self-paced, digital learning course covers a variety of processes and areas related to students with Special Educational Needs (SEN) and the role of a SENCO within Arbor.
This course contains ten sections of self-paced, digital learning content:
Equips staff with the knowledge and skills to access, interpret and manage SEN information within Arbor, ensuring accurate student profiles and effective support for learners with special educational needs.
Shows how to accurately add, edit and manage Special Educational Needs (SEN) information in Arbor, ensuring compliance with DfE requirements and maintaining complete, up-to-date student records.
Equips SENCOs with the skills to accurately record, manage and access students’ medical and dietary information in Arbor, ensuring key needs are visible and up‑to‑date across the system.
Shows how to create and use Custom Groups in Arbor to automatically organise SEN students and efficiently manage communication and reporting.
Teaches how to create, manage and update SEN events in Arbor, including logging meetings, adding participants and recording follow‑up outcomes.
Teaches how to record, manage and track student communications, notes and attachments within Arbor to ensure accurate, complete and easily accessible SEN-related information.
Shows how to view, manage and apply SEN Exam Access Arrangements to ensure students receive appropriate support during examinations.
Shows how to create, customise and share SEN reports in Arbor so you can effectively track student needs and communicate insights with staff and families.
Shows how to access, download and use SEN-related reports and templates from the DMS Portal and how to generate personalised letters through mail merge using Arbor’s Custom Report Writer.
Introduces how to view, manage and report on student interventions within Arbor, using dashboards and provision mapping tools to support effective monitoring and record‑keeping.
